Signaturefd LLC grew its stake in AT&T Inc. (NYSE:T - Free Report) by 5.6% during the second qu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 171,735 shares of the technology company's stock after purchasing an additional 9,082 shares during the quarter. Signaturefd LLC's holdings in AT&T were worth $4,970,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

AT&T Stock Performance
Shares of T opened at $28.31 on Friday. The company has a 50-day moving average of $28.61 and a two-hundred day moving average of $27.87. The company has a current ratio of 0.81, a quick ratio of 0.76 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.01. The stock has a market cap of $202.43 billion, a P/E ratio of 16.09, a PEG ratio of 3.62 and a beta of 0.44. AT&T Inc. has a 12-month low of $21.05 and a 12-month high of $29.79.
AT&T (NYSE:T -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, July 23rd. The technology company reported $0.54 EPS for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.53 by $0.01. AT&T had a net margin of 10.29% and a return on equity of 13.36%. The firm had revenue of $30.85 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$30.44 billion. During the same quarter in the prior year, the business posted $0.51 earnings per share. AT&T's revenue for the quarter was up 3.4% compared to the same quarter last year. As a group, research analysts predict that AT&T Inc. will post 2.14 EPS for the current fiscal year.
AT&T Announces Dividend
The business also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Monday, November 3rd. Shareholders of record on Friday, October 10th will be paid a dividend of $0.2775 per share. This represents a $1.11 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 3.9%. The ex-dividend date is Friday, October 10th. AT&T's dividend payout ratio is 63.07%.

About AT&T
(
Free Report)
AT&T, Inc is a holding company, which engages in the provision of telecommunications and technology services. It operates through the Communications and Latin America segments. The Communications segment offers wireless, wireline telecom, and broadband services to businesses and consumers located in the US and businesses globally.
